Panel approves bill allowing certified mine rescue vehicles to use red warning lights

Summary
House Bill 2211, which would add certified mine rescue team vehicles to the list of vehicles permitted to use red and red-and-white flashing warning lights, was reported by the subcommittee 5-0. Supporters said the change would reduce response time in life-or-death mine incidents.
